Mucus on/in stool: If the colonoscopy was normal, and you don't normally suffer from chronic diarrhea, this most likely sounds like constipation. Your colon makes mucus to help ease the transit of stool.

Fiber and water: Increasing you intake of fiber and water may help. You may take a fiber laxative like Metamucil and drink enough water daily so that your urine is colorless. For the long term you may try to increase your intake of fiber foods.
